python xlsx 导出表格超链接

该Python脚本用于从Excel文件中的第一列提取所有超链接并保存到一个文本文件中。首先,脚本导入必要的库并定义输入和输出文件的路径。然后,它确保输出文件的目录存在。接着,脚本加载Excel文件并选择活动工作表。通过遍历第一列的所有单元格,脚本检查每个单元格是否包含超链接。如果找到超链接,就将其写入到输出文本文件中,并在控制台中打印保存的超链接。最后,脚本在完成导出后提示用户超链接导出完成。

import os
import openpyxl

# pip install openpyxl 


# 定义输入Excel文件和输出文件
excel_file = r'E:\1.xlsx'
output_file = r'E:\1.txt'

# 确保输出文件的目录存在
os.makedirs(os.path.dirname(output_file), exist_ok=True)

# 打开Excel文件
wb = openpyxl.load_workbook(excel_file)
sheet = wb.active

# 打开输出文件
with open(output_file, 'w') as file:
    # 遍历A1列中的所有单元格
    for row in sheet.iter_rows(min_row=1, min_col=1, max_col=1):
        for cell in row:
            # 获取超链接
            if cell.hyperlink:
                hyperlink = cell.hyperlink.target
                # 写入超链接到输出文件
                file.write(hyperlink + '\n')
                print(f"保存超链接: {hyperlink}")

print("超链接导出完成!")

相关推荐

  1. python xlsx 导出表格

    2024-07-11 01:50:01       10 阅读
  2. word导出

    2024-07-11 01:50:01       40 阅读

最近更新

  1. docker php8.1+nginx base 镜像 dockerfile 配置

    2024-07-11 01:50:01       7 阅读
  2. Could not load dynamic library ‘cudart64_100.dll‘

    2024-07-11 01:50:01       6 阅读
  3. 在Django里面运行非项目文件

    2024-07-11 01:50:01       5 阅读
  4. Python语言-面向对象

    2024-07-11 01:50:01       9 阅读

热门阅读

  1. qt 子线程更新ui举例

    2024-07-11 01:50:01       9 阅读
  2. python——解决字节转义的问题

    2024-07-11 01:50:01       12 阅读
  3. Spring源码(二) refresh () 方法

    2024-07-11 01:50:01       10 阅读
  4. GraalVM简介及使用

    2024-07-11 01:50:01       10 阅读
  5. 徐州服务器租用:论带宽的作用有哪些

    2024-07-11 01:50:01       10 阅读
  6. 1. Go 九九乘法表

    2024-07-11 01:50:01       11 阅读
  7. Perl词法作用域:自定义编程环境的构建术

    2024-07-11 01:50:01       11 阅读
  8. SQL Server 设置端口详解

    2024-07-11 01:50:01       11 阅读